New Zealand: Black Sticks wrap up the series vs USA

Despite another torrential downpour in Napier, the Black Sticks have managed a 2-nil win over the USA in the third match of their hockey series.


New Zealand now has an unassailable 3-nil lead in the five game series.


First half goals from Jaimee Provan and Suzie Muirhead secured the win.


For the second consecutive night it poured with rain, and Black Sticks forward Niniwa Roberts-Lang says it certainly made life difficult.


However, raining or not they have wrapped up the series and Roberts-Lang is delighted with the effort.


She says they made a good start, with the Americans having little to offer in the second half.


The fourth test is in Levin on Thursday.
